Compare all specifications:
1972 Maserati Mexico | 1972 Vauxhall Victor | |
Make | Maserati | Vauxhall |
Model | Mexico | Victor |
Year Released | 1972 | 1972 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 4719 cc | 2279 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 0 HP | 109 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1480 kg | 1160 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4770 mm | 4570 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1740 mm | 1710 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1360 mm | 1360 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2650 mm | 2680 mm |
